SIP, the session initiation protocol, is an open protocol for VoIP and other text and multimedia sessions, like instant messaging, voice, video and other services. Your problem: I am tring to force a codec (0, 98) any one that the trial will support. I have tried adding the setting &net.rtp.audio.payloadtype=0 into BSS dial plan, but for some reason it is still picking 18 and not 0. I have been at this for a few days now, reading the forum and i am still stuck. I can register no problem. The PBX answers the call, and 'tries' to play the auto attendent message but i get back only mis-matched codec sounds.
